About Yesterday, I visited the Heritage Village in Dubai during the Shopping Festival.. I took lots of pictures, but my fav were pix of the animals (or birds).. this is the first of the series: the Falcon.
It's the symbol of United Arab Emirates.. was used to hunt different kinds of birds for eating purposes, but unfortunately also for fun.. untill it was banned to hunt specific endangered species.. it's blind folded so it won't freak out when it sees people, and it's legs are tied so it won't fly..
